The BCBA certification exam covers a broad range of topics related to behavior analysis, including behavioral assessment, intervention design, implementation, and evaluation. It also includes topics related to ethical and professional practices in behavior analysis. BCBA-KR exam is designed to assess the ability of candidates to apply the principles of behavior analysis in real-world situations and to make data-driven decisions.

Passing the BCBA exam is a major milestone for behavior analysts, as it is widely recognized as a mark of professional competence and expertise in the field. Certification as a BCBA can open up many career opportunities, including working in schools, clinics, hospitals, and other settings where behavior analysis is applied. Additionally, BCBA certification is often required by insurance companies and other funding sources for behavior analysis services, making it a valuable credential for those who wish to provide services in these settings.
